Advice for those who Share Ahadith: Do Not Share each and every single Narration with general people. It will confuse them or they will misinterpret it. Or They will not be able to Absorb it. Do not Share Too much Narrations of Just Reward (Sawab) as it can make them Greedy and they will solely depend on it. Do not share too Much Narrations of Apprehensions and punishment as they can effect their psychology negatively. Quran shows us the perfect Balance between Sawaab & Azaab, Awareness & Apprehension. ------------------------------------- Imam Bukhari Narrates a long Hadith in which it comes: Once Mu`adh was along with Allahs Messenger (ﷺ) as a companion rider. Allahs Messenger (ﷺ) said some thing to Muadh (R.A) Mu`adh said, O Allahs Messenger (ﷺ) ! Should I not inform the people about it so that they may have glad tidings? He replied, When the people hear about it, they will solely depend on it. Then Mu`adh narrated the above-mentioned Hadith just before his death, being afraid of committing sin (by not telling the knowledge and it was his personal Ijtihad). -------------------------------------- And Imam Muslim Narrated in Muqaddamah. Ibn e Masud R.A said: It is the case that you do not relate to the people a narration which their minds cannot grasp except that it becomes a Fitnah for some of them. So Keep sharing Ahadith But in Balance. :)
